Lucasium wombeyi

Species of lizard From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Remove ads

The Pilbara ground gecko (Lucasium wombeyi) also known commonly as Wombey's gecko, is a species of lizard in the family Diplodactylidae. The species is endemic to Australia.

Etymology

The specific name, wombeyi, is in honour of Australian herpetologist John C. Wombey.[3]

Geographic range

L. wombeyi is found in the Pilbara region, in the Australian state of Western Australia.[2]

Habitat

The preferred natural habitats of L. wombeyi are grassland and rocky areas.[1]

Reproduction

L. wombeyi is oviparous.[2]
